摘要:本文旨在介绍数控车床编程的基础知识和核心技术。首先介绍数控车床编程的概念和优势,然后详细讲解数控车床常用的编程语言和常用指令。接着,讲解数控车床编程中常见的错误和排除方法。最后,总结数控车床编程的理论和实践知识,为读者提供完整的数控车床编程指南。
1、数控车床编程简介
数控车床编程是通过使用计算机控制车床的运动轨迹和速度,实现零件的加工和制造。与传统车床相比,数控车床编程具有以下优势:
1)提高生产效率,减少操作人员的劳动强度;
2)保证零件的加工精度,提高产品质量;
3)可编程性强,适应性广泛,能够完成各种复杂的加工任务。
2、数控车床编程语言和指令
数控车床编程语言是指用于编写数控车床程序的语言,常见的有G代码、M代码和T代码等。其中,G代码是最常用的一种语言,用于描述车床的运动轨迹和速度。
G代码中常用的指令包括:
1)G00:快速定位指令,用于让车刀快速移动到目标位置;
2)G01:直线插补指令,用于让车刀沿直线路径移动;
3)G02和G03:圆弧插补指令,用于让车刀沿圆弧路径移动;
4)G28和G29:返回参考点指令,用于让车刀回到机床坐标系的原点位置。
3、数控车床编程中的错误和排除方法
数控车床编程中常见的错误包括程序错误、机床错误和工件错误等。例如,程序错误可能是由于程序代码编写错误、语法错误或参数设置错误导致的。针对这些错误,应该采取以下排除方法:
1)检查程序代码,确保代码逻辑正确;
2)检查程序语法,确保符合编程规范和语言特点;
3)检查参数设置,确保参数值正确。
4、数控车床编程的总结归纳
本文介绍了数控车床编程的基础知识和核心技术。在实际编程中,需要熟练掌握编程语言和常用指令,避免出现常见的编程错误。此外,还需要掌握常见的排除方法,确保程序的正确性和稳定性。本文为读者提供了完整的数控车床编程指南,带领读者从零起步,掌握核心技术。